Three thieves broke into a restaurant and stole a cash box.

The incident occurred at the Cinnamon restaurant in Thompson Close, St Albans, at around 4.30am on Wednesday, January 31.

The thieves are believed to be men and are described as being of slim to athletic build and wearing hooded tops.

One of them was carrying a bag and another was wearing a top with a bright badge on the left hand side of the chest area.

PCSO Tom Perrin said: “We know that the offenders made off towards The Putterills and were also in the Westfield Road area.

“I’m appealing for anyone who saw anything suspicious in these areas or around the Cinnamon restaurant to get in touch with me as you may have information that could assist our investigation.”
